CIArb's Young Members Group is pleased to invite anyone aged 40 years and under on the date of submission to participate in the CIArb YMG writing competitions. This year’s competition invites participants to prepare a procedural order and explanatory note in relation to virtual hearings. For further details and guidelines, please refer to the YMG Essay Competition brochure here.
The Essay Competition will be judged by an Editorial Jury (Alexander G. Leventhal ACIArb, Mercy Okiro MCIArb, João Marçal Martins ACIArb, Elizabeth Rainbow Willard ACIArb, and Dharam Jumani FCIArb) and an Honorary Jury (Olufunke Adekoya FCIArb, Professor Mohamed Abdel Wahab MCIArb, and Michael Mcilwrath).
The winner will be invited to speak at the CIArb YMG virtual seminar held in November 2020 and will also be profiled in the CIArb YMG newsletter. The five finalist submissions shall be published on the CIArb website.
Deadline date: 1 October 2020 (midnight London time)
Entries should be submitted to: essay@ciarb.org

Significant progress on Advisory Centre for International Investment Law at UNCITRALIn 2017, UNCITRAL Working Group III (WGIII) was launched and was tasked with working on procedural reform of the investor state dispute settlement (ISDS) system. From 1-5 April 2024, Ciarb participated in the 48th session of WGIII in its capacity as an observer delegate.
